Subject: [xsl] HOWTO: convert flat list w/ level information to a hierarchial one? From: "Marcus Zelezny" <Marcus.Zelezny@xxxxxx> Date: Tue, 2 Dec 2003 11:40:58 +0100 |
Dear XSLT Community!
I couldn't solve a problem of class "flat file transform".
>From (@name, just for illustration) flat file with @level information:
<node>
<node level="0" type="c" name="toplevel"/>
<node level="1" type="i" name="1. item"/>
<node level="1" type="c" name="2. container"/>
<node level="2" type="i" name="2.1 item"/>
<node level="2" type="i" name="2.2 item"/>
<node level="1" type="i" name="3. item"/><!-- implicit close of previous container -->
<node level="1" type="c" name="4. container"/>
<node level="2" type="i" name="4.1 item"/>
<node level="2" type="c" name="4.2 container"/>
<node level="3" type="i" name="4.2.1 item"/>
</node>
<!--
@type = 'c' ... container
@type = 'i' ... Item
-->
transform to:
<node>
<node type="c" name="toplevel">
<node type="i" name="1. item"/>
<node type="c" name="2. container"/>
<node type="i" name="2.1 item"/>
<node type="i" name="2.2 item"/>
</node>
<node type="i" name="3. item"/>
<node type="c" name="4. container">
<node type="i" name="4.1 item"/>
<node type="c" name="4.2 container"/>
<node type="i" name="4.2.1 item"/>
</node>
</node>
</node>
</node>
What I tried:
Calling recursively a template with passing parameters $node, $last-level, but I failed to leave recursion in a proper way;-(
Any pointer|hint|solution for a (ideally) XSLT1.0 approach is highly appreciated!
